Police file additional charges against President Yoon for ”obstructing the execution of an arrest warrant” - South Korea
President Yoon Seok-yeol has been charged with mobilizing the Presidential Security Service to obstruct the execution of an arrest warrant against him.
The police's special martial law investigation team has filed charges against President Yoon for obstructing the execution of an arrest warrant and is investigating him.
On the 21st, President Yoon announced that he was being investigated for obstruction of justice on the basis of a complaint filed by the Fatherland Reform Party on the 3rd of last month.
Because President Yoon is the current president, he will not be indicted in this regard.
The police believe that the Guard's blocking of an arrest warrant for President Yoon was ordered by President Yoon.
Police also obtained messages exchanged between President Yoon and Kim Sung-Hoon, deputy chief of the Security Service, on the 3rd and 7th of last month via the encrypted messaging app Signal.
Police have transferred six military personnel, including Director General of the Defense Intelligence Agency, who were charged with treason, to the High-Ranking Public Officials Crime Investigation Agency.
Today, the Public Prosecutor's Office is conducting searches of Won's office and other premises.
